Look at the pretty lights
This Christmas there are an abundance of alternative festive light shows and arty installations springing up across the countryside that shouldn't be missed. In Liverpool, internationally renowned French artist
Franck Scurti has been commissioned to design a series of
striking light installations for Kirkdale, Kensington and Garston. In London Anya Gallaccio, a former Turner Prize nominee has been commissioned by The Hayward to create a new display of festive lights while David Batchelor's popular display
Festival Remix has returned to the Southbank Centre. In Bristol you can take an evening stroll through an
Enchanted Wood (until 23 December), and there will also be
a week of light shows around across the city between 17 and 21 December. In the north east don't miss
Northumberland Lights 2007, which will feature various guerrilla lighting events across the region, and in Newcastle, make sure you check out this year's
